I also have a 96 eclipse nt with nitrous, My first mod was a nitrous and had no idea what i was doing, all I wanted was to go fast and ended up blowing my stock plastic intake because I didn't know that the bottle had to be at a certain pressure to spray, nitrous is alot of fun to use if you know what your doing, I purchased a nitrous work fogger kit and did the installation myself since im a installer, it wasn't to hard, the only hard part was spliting the fuel line but there are kits out there that would screw in to the fuel rail pressure test plug for easy installation. I would recomend starting with a 30 35 shot and work your way up, but dont spray more than 75 untill you do the bottom half of your motor and dont forget to retard your timing about 2 degrees. note 30 50 75 shot could run on stock fuel pump and air fuel ratio or a pryometer is a must so you dont run your engine lean, and check your plugs often they will foul up very quickly depending how much you spray, if you dont your car will back fire at idle and upon take off for the reason of fouled plugs. I also recomend autolite resistor plugs and gap it .32 thousand they are cheap and they will last longer than any plugs out there, trust me I tried them all.
